Supports Formation of Brain Synapses and Neuronal Membranes, Supports Liver Mitochondrial Function, Dietary Supplement, Uridine is a nucleotide that acts as a precursor needed – in conjunction with the omega-3 fatty acid docosahexaenoic acid (DHA) and the B vitamin-like compound choline – for the synthesis of membrane phospholipids and brain synapses. It may enhance some brain cholinergic functions. Uridine also supports the health and function of liver mitochondria.
